As demand for glucagon-like peptide-1 (GLP-1) drugs continues to grow, ensuring these products meet regulatory standards while delivering fast, reliable results is critical. Traditional amino acid analysis (AAA) workflows offer valuable quantitative insights into bioprocess conditions during production but are often time-consuming and complex.

In this webinar we will introduce a streamlined, microwave-assisted UPLC approach designed to rapidly hydrolyze, label, and identify GLP-1 analogs using the Waters AccQ·Tag Ultra Chemistry Kit. Discover how this turnkey solution expedites amino acid analysis while maintaining accuracy and reliability in conjunction with Empower™ Chromatography Data System (CDS) workflows.

Presenter: Duanduan Han, Ph.D. (Senior Scientist, Waters Corporation)

Duanduan Han, Ph.D., is a Senior Scientist at Waters Corporation in Milford, MA. Her work has focused on LC/MS method development and troubleshooting, impurity profiling, raw material screening of GLP-1s, lipid nanoparticles, surfactants, oligonucleotides, mAbs, and other biologic drug products.

She received her Ph.D. in chemical engineering from Texas A&M University.

Presenter: Tim Anderson, Ph.D. (Senior Product Manager, Waters Corporation)

Tim Anderson, Ph.D., has received advanced degrees in Analytical Chemistry and Food Science related to extraction and MS analysis of proteins at Iowa State University. He has industry experience with large manufacturing product analysis and fit-for-use testing.

Tim has been at Waters working with consumables for 3 years and is Senior Product Manager for AccQ·Tag Ultra solutions.
